Entry Level Pest Control Salary in the United States

How much does an Entry Level Pest Control make in the United States?

As of April 01, 2026, the average salary for an Entry Level Pest Control in the United States is $37,693 per year, which breaks down to an hourly rate of $18.

However, an Entry Level Pest Control's salary can vary significantly. Here’s a look at the typical salary range:

  • Top Earners (90th percentile): $46,493
  • Majority Range (25th-75th percentile): $34,814 to $42,299
  • Entry-Level (10th percentile): $32,193

How Do Entry Level Pest Control Salaries Vary from State to State?

Your salary can change significantly depending on where you work. States with a higher cost of living and strong industrial sectors often pay more to attract Entry Level Pest Controls. For example, consider the average annual salaries in these key locations:

  • District of Columbia: $41,733.
  • California: $41,575.
  • Massachusetts: $41,021.

Top Paying Cities for Entry Level Pest Controls

Salaries can also vary between different cities. Major metropolitan areas or cities with a high demand for technicians often offer more competitive pay. Here are a few examples of average annual salaries in different U.S. cities:

  • San Jose: $47,542
  • San Francisco: $47,074
  • Oakland: $46,030

Salary Trends for Entry Level Pest Control

Salaries for an Entry Level Pest Control can change over time, reflecting shifts in market demand and the overall economy. The median salary decreased from $37,004 in 2023 to around $36,463 in 2025, reflecting changes in demand, location, experience, and the wider economy.
